Hey Tamsin — handing off tenant quotas on Meterline. Quick notes for support: quotas reset hourly, bursts allowed up to 2x for 60 seconds, and enterprise tenants get a separate pool. If someone claims they're throttled unfairly, check their tier first. Defaults rarely change, so escalate any mismatch. Current quota settings are as follows.

deployment values, tafof-taduf:
pelius:
  pin: 6508
  tenant: praiel
  seal: seal_4e33a2f4
  metrics_host: metrics.pelius.plorvagrid.corp
  standby_team: druix
  escalation: juldor-norius
  nonce: 5db598

## Autocomplete latency — Quickfind index

If p95 on the Quickfind suggest endpoint exceeds 400ms, check whether the nightly reindex on the Larkspur cluster overlapped with peak traffic. Most slowdowns trace back to an undersized segment cache after the index swap. Before patching, confirm the running service matches the expected settings below.

config for kafof-bawef:
holath:
  log_level: debug
  metrics_host: metrics.holath.qorvelsys.internal
  pin: 2191
  pool_size: 32

To: Executive Team
Cc: Sales Leads
Subject: Greywick Stores pilot

The eight-store pilot with Greywick Stores begins next month. Shelf placement is confirmed, merchandising kits ship next week, and their category manager has agreed to weekly sell-through reports. Success criteria are a 12% attach rate by week six. The context driving this pilot is summarised below.

management briefing: Project Ulavan slips by two quarters because of the staffing delay.